Humble beginnings.

Inspired by Cincinnati’s deep connection to the Ohio River, Ben Bernstein and river industry pioneer Betty Blake envisioned a new way for people to experience the river and the city surrounding it. Together, they created experiences built around authentic riverboat charm, unforgettable views, dining, entertainment, and the timeless romance of classic river travel.

What began as a bold idea quickly became one of Cincinnati’s most beloved traditions. Generations of guests have gathered aboard BB Riverboats to celebrate, relax, sightsee, dine, and create memories on the water. More than four decades later, that same passion for the river continues to guide every cruise experience today.

The Belle of Cincinnati

Cruising into the future.

BB Riverboats quickly became an important part of Cincinnati’s riverfront culture and history. From earning exclusive operating rights at the 1982 World’s Fair in Knoxville to playing a major role in Cincinnati’s legendary Tall Stacks festivals throughout the late 1980s, 1990s, and early 2000s — and again during the return of the celebration as River Roots Festival in 2025 — BB Riverboats has remained deeply connected to the Ohio River and the communities surrounding it.

Today, BB Riverboats continues to be family-owned and operated by Alan Bernstein and his children, Terri and Ben Bernstein, alongside a dedicated team passionate about preserving the tradition, hospitality, and experience of authentic riverboat travel for future generations.

The Port of Cincinnati

Shortly after opening, BB Riverboats began operating from the historic Mike Fink before eventually establishing its permanent home on Riverboat Row in Newport, Kentucky, just steps from the Roebling Suspension Bridge and the downtown Cincinnati skyline.

Today, guests from across the country visit BB Riverboats to experience sightseeing cruises, dining cruises, private events, and authentic riverboat hospitality along the Ohio River. Captain Alan Bernstein

Alan Bernstein

Alan Bernstein began his river career by skipping his high school graduation to accept a deckhand position aboard the legendary Delta Queen in 1970, beginning a lifelong connection to the river industry that continues today. Holding multiple Master’s licenses for Western Rivers and inland waterways, Alan has spent decades helping shape riverboat operations, tourism, and hospitality throughout the region.As the longtime patriarch of the Bernstein family and one of the most recognizable personalities on the river, Alan is known not only for his leadership and experience, but also for his storytelling, humor, and genuine love of river life. Guests and crew alike know that spending time with Captain Alan usually means hearing a great story from decades spent on the Ohio River.

In addition to leading BB Riverboats alongside his family, Alan has served in numerous leadership roles within the Passenger Vessel Association and regional tourism organizations. His contributions to America’s river industry earned him recognition in the National Rivers Hall of Fame.

Ben Bernstein

Ben Bernstein represents the third generation of the Bernstein family to operate BB Riverboats in the Port of Cincinnati and has been involved in the family business since 1993. A graduate of Dixie Heights High School and the University of Kentucky, Ben combines lifelong hands-on river experience with leadership roles throughout the passenger vessel industry. He holds a 1600-ton Inland Master’s license and a 200-ton Master of Towing license for the Western Rivers.

Alongside his sister, Terri, Ben now helps lead and operate BB Riverboats with their father, Alan Bernstein, continuing the family tradition of authentic riverboat hospitality on the Ohio River. In addition to his work aboard the boats, Ben has served on the Board of Directors for the Passenger Vessel Association and previously chaired the organization’s Safety and Security Committee, helping guide industry standards and operations nationwide.

Terri Bernstein

Terri Bernstein

Terri Bernstein is part of the third generation leading BB Riverboats and has spent her life around the riverboat industry. A graduate of Dixie Heights High School, she earned a Bachelor’s Degree in Hotel, Restaurant, and Tourism Management from Western Kentucky University, along with a Bachelor’s Degree in Paralegal Studies from Purdue University. Terri brings decades of operational, hospitality, and leadership experience to the family business.

In addition to helping oversee BB Riverboats, Terri is a Past President of the Passenger Vessel Association and currently serves on the organization’s Regulatory and Membership Committees. She also sits on the Board of Directors and serves as Treasurer of the Haunted Attraction Association, while remaining active in tourism, hospitality, and entertainment organizations throughout the region.
